Gemini’s successful Nasdaq debut fundamentally reconfigures the perception of digital asset exchanges within traditional financial markets. This public listing directly impacts market liquidity by integrating a significant crypto entity into established equity frameworks. The event signals a maturing market structure, attracting capital from institutional investors who seek regulated exposure to the digital asset class.

Consequences include increased transparency requirements for listed entities and a potential acceleration of similar public offerings, which will collectively bolster the systemic integrity of the crypto-financial complex. The oversubscription of the IPO demonstrates a clear appetite for crypto-linked equities, establishing a precedent for future capital formation strategies within the sector.

The Gemini Nasdaq listing reinforces institutional confidence in crypto infrastructure, setting a precedent for capital market integration and systemic maturation.

  • Market Valuation ▴ US$4.4 billion
  • Capital Raised ▴ US$425 million
  • IPO Oversubscription ▴ 20 times
